Transaction 25577cd011f61675bada916669043645a334d37f68b4323f11d39b7981635535

2 Input
2 Outputs
  • 25577cd011f61675bada916669043645a334d37f68b4323f11d39b7981635535:0
  • value  2876548
    address  13qFa3X6Vg69f28TRpui8BfHFQx35Zakhf
  • 25577cd011f61675bada916669043645a334d37f68b4323f11d39b7981635535:1
  • value  17041869
    address  16htVmuMsisFk4YsQDCCMiHbuDJjmiSAe2